Maruti Suzuki India Limited (MSIL) continues to evolve from a traditional automobile manufacturer into a technology-driven mobility company. The company now invests ₹2 crore in a Bengaluru-based connected-mobility intelligence startup, Ravity Software Solutions Private Limited. Maruti Suzuki makes this investment through its in-house Maruti Suzuki Innovation Fund, which supports young technology ventures that align with the company’s long-term digital roadmap.

Understanding the Investment

Maruti Suzuki acquires about 7.84% equity in Ravity Software Solutions through this ₹2 crore infusion. This investment strengthens the ongoing collaboration between India’s largest carmaker and emerging mobility-tech innovators.

By choosing Ravity Software Solutions for its third investment under the Innovation Fund, the company highlights how deeply it values data-driven mobility solutions. The Innovation Fund previously invested in Amlgo Labs Private Limited in March 2024 and Sociograph Solutions in June 2022, both of which specialise in analytics and AI technologies.

Ravity Software Solutions, founded in 2022, focuses on turning connected-vehicle data into actionable insights for OEMs, fleet operators, and mobility platforms. The company develops intelligence dashboards, analytics engines, and diagnostic tools that transform raw data from connected vehicles into useful business and engineering information.


Why Maruti Suzuki Chooses Ravity Software Solutions

Maruti Suzuki wants to strengthen its capabilities in telematics, real-time diagnostics, predictive maintenance, and mobility intelligence. Ravity offers exactly these solutions.

  1. AI-Driven Analytics
    Ravity uses AI models that read vehicle data and generate predictions about performance, maintenance needs, and behavioural patterns. These insights help companies reduce operational costs and improve safety.
  2. OEM-Focused Solutions
    The platform supports automobile manufacturers by improving vehicle health monitoring, warranty analytics, breakdown prediction, and post-sales service quality.
  3. Fleet-Based Intelligence
    Ravity helps fleet owners track utilisation, fuel efficiency, driver behaviour, and route optimisation.

Maruti Suzuki sees this startup as a critical partner for enhancing its connected-vehicle ecosystem. As more Maruti vehicles now include telematics units, vehicle-health monitoring systems, and GPS-enabled features, the company needs smart analytics to handle massive amounts of data. Ravity provides the tools and intelligence to support this transformation.
